Doug Durham is a seasoned technology executive and entrepreneur with over 25 years of experience founding and scaling software engineering organizations that turn early ideas into market-ready products. As Co-Founder and CEO Emeritus of Don’t Panic Labs, he blends deep technical experience—from architecting ecommerce and CDN platforms to leading R&D—with a disciplined approach to product development and engineering culture. He advises growth-stage, software-enabled companies on technology strategy, digital transformation, and talent-driven scaling, bringing board-level governance perspective alongside hands-on mentorship. His background includes roles as CTO, adjunct faculty, and a Major in the Missouri Air National Guard, reflecting uncommon cross-domain leadership in both technical and operational environments. Based in Lincoln, Nebraska, he is known for cultivating craftsmanship, continuous learning, and practical innovation discipline that sustains long-term business value.
